Job Description

Spacious Skies Campgrounds is a dynamic and fast-growing outdoor hospitality company committed to creating inclusive and welcoming experiences for all guests. Established in 2021, the company operates a collection of unique campgrounds located throughout the eastern United States. Spacious Skies has cultivated a strong brand identity rooted in genuine inclusion, exceptional guest experiences, and a belief that outdoor spaces should be accessible to everyone regardless of background. Their partnerships with organizations such as The Unity Folks, LGBT Outdoors, Girl Camper, RVShare, and Latino Outdoors demonstrate their deep commitment to diversity and outreach within the outdoor recreation community. Job Duties

  • Lead all campground operations end-to-end including guest services, maintenance, housekeeping, retail, and programming
  • Hire, develop, and retain a motivated, high-performing team that reflects the values of the brand
  • Drive financial results by managing the operating budget, monitoring revenue, controlling costs, and delivering on NOI targets
  • Own the guest experience from first impression to final checkout, resolving concerns and creating memorable moments
  • Maintain the physical property to a high standard ensuring cleanliness, safety, and pride
  • Represent Spacious Skies in the surrounding community, building local relationships
  • Collaborate with HQ on pricing strategies, marketing initiatives, and brand programs
  • Serve as the on-call leader for after-hours needs and unexpected situations responding with calm, judgment, and confidence
  • Ensure compliance with all local, state, and company safety and regulatory requirements
